A Legacy of Hope: The Journey of Ruben Hernandez

Ruben Hernandez came to the U.S. at twenty, and three years later, a tragic gunshot left him blind. Instead of despair, he saw a new purpose and founded UDLA. For nearly forty years, UDLA has been a beacon of hope, offering free services to hundreds of disabled individuals and their families.

Ruben’s blindness became his greatest gift, pushing him to become a tireless advocate for the disabled. His vision for UDLA was simple yet profound: to improve the quality of life for physically challenged individuals and help them reclaim their self-esteem.
